Medical imaging in Melbourne's outer north, VIC

There are 35 accredited imaging practices across 45 suburbs in Melbourne's outer north.

Between them they run x-ray at 35 sites, ultrasound at 35 sites, CT at 31 sites, MRI at 9 sites, nuclear medicine at 4 sites and PET at 2 sites.

The scarcest scans here are PET — if your referral is for one of those, check the suburb page before you drive, because the nearest machine may be in a different suburb from the rest of your care.

Five practices in Melbourne's outer north appear on the Government's Medicare-eligible MRI list, so a Medicare rebate is possible for an MRI there. Any other MRI unit in the region is accredited but not on that list.
